Hyderabad: The Director General of Police for Telangana, Dr. Jitender, recently reviewed the Telangana Cyber Security Bureau (TGCSB) on Monday. He suggested that the TGCSB should serve as a support centre for police officers investigating cybercrimes in the state. This support would include providing technical assistance through a system that helps police units address issues using a ticket-raising module.

Shikha Goel, the Director of the Cyber Security Bureau, gave a tour of the Bureau and explained the different units that are currently in operation. During the meeting, she also outlined the goals of the TGCSB. These goals include reorganizing existing units, forming a joint operations unit for executing PT warrants, and tracking habitual cyber offenders by opening suspect sheets on them. The Bureau is also working on solving problems related to mule accounts and sending teams to other states to arrest cybercriminals.

One of the main topics discussed during the meeting was the upcoming event called Cyber Jagrooktha Diwas, which will take place in November. This event will focus on raising cyber safety awareness, particularly for senior citizens.
